To add to our team of talented people, we are currently seeking an Administrative Assistant for our Suwanee, GA office.
This is an entry level position with pay ranging from $10-12/hr. The job is responsible for performing administrative and office support activities, in addition to:
· Provides daily phone support in order to ensure proper phone coverage. (All receptionist duties as assigned)
· Executes collection procedures for unpaid invoices and maintains information for all insufficient funds received.
· Receives, distributes, prepares and routes incoming, mail, e-mails and faxes.
· Creates Bill of Ladings using various shipping vendors.
· Submits tracks and investigates shipping claims with retailers and vendors.
· Creates POs into the accounting system and tracks the transaction and maintains departmental database and produces and updates internal reports
· Organizes and maintains file system, and other correspondence and records.
· Completes credit and debit activities on retailer’s accounts
· Prepares bank deposits on a daily basis while using the segregation of duties and audit guidelines.
· Responsible for obtaining bank and internal information for company check acceptances.
· Other duties as required. This list is not meant to be a comprehensive inventory of all duties and responsibilities assigned to this position.
High School diploma or GED and 1 year of related experience and/or training. One year of related experience and/or training.
